Step-by-Step Guide: How to Add Remote to Gemini Gate Motor

Adding a remote to your Gemini gate motor is easy. We’ll guide you through the setup process. You’ll soon pair your remote with the gate motor effortlessly.

Gemini gate remote setup instructions

Find the control board on your Gemini gate motor. Look for the ‘Add remote’ function. Press the button on the remote you want to programme.

Now, assign a function to the button. Options include trigger, pedestrian, free-exit, Holiday Lockout, or courtesy light control. Repeat these steps for each remote.

  1. Press and hold the transmitter button
  2. Press and release the learn button on the PCB
  3. Wait for the receiver LED on the PCB to flash twice
  4. Repeat for additional transmitters

To finish, press the LEARN button for 10 seconds. Wait until the receiver LED turns off. This resets the remote memory.

Troubleshooting Common Issues During Remote Programming

Our Gemini remote troubleshooting guide addresses common problems and solutions. It covers issues you might face when adding a remote to your Gemini gate motor.

Remote Not Responding After Programming

If your remote isn’t working, first check the battery. A flat battery is often the issue. Ensure you’re within range of the motor.

If problems continue, try resetting the remote memory. You can do this on the control board. Then, reprogram the remote.

Limited Range Issues

For limited range problems, replace the remote’s battery. Other devices might be causing interference. Try changing the remote’s frequency if your model allows it.

Interference from Other Devices

Electronic devices can interfere with your gate remote. Move potential interference sources away from the gate area. Some Gemini models offer an ‘Autolearn’ mode to help overcome interference issues.

4. How do I delete a lost or stolen Gemini remote?

Most Gemini models have a ‘Delete remote by ID’ function on the control board. Find the remote ID, then use this function to remove it from the system’s memory.
